Travelling from Seoul to Istanbul: what you need to know

  • Get your holiday planning started by considering where you'll catch your flight from Seoul to Istanbul. Incheon International Airport (ICN) and Gimpo International Airport (GMP) are the main airports in Seoul.

  • When working out where to arrive in Istanbul, Istanbul Airport (IST) and Istanbul Sabiha Airport (SAW) are the major entry points.

  • The average duration of a direct Seoul to Istanbul flight is 11 hours 50 minutes.

  • Istanbul is six hours behind Seoul and is in the UTC+3 timezone.

  • With 19 weekly flights between the two airports, Incheon International Airport (ICN) to Istanbul Airport (IST) is the busiest route. Arriving in Istanbul

Istanbul Airport (IST)

  • Istanbul Airport (IST) to central Istanbul takes about 45 minutes by car. The centre is roughly 32 kilometres away.

  • Getting to the centre by public transport will take you around 1 hour 10 minutes.

Best time to go to Istanbul

  • August is the busiest month for flights from Seoul to Istanbul. To avoid the crowds, visit Istanbul in March.

  • Before locking in your Seoul to Istanbul tickets, think about the weather you're most comfortable in. July is the warmest month in Istanbul, with temperatures ranging from 21ºC (70ºF) to 30ºC (86ºF).

  • Search for cheap flights from Seoul to Istanbul in January if you want to travel in cooler conditions. Temperatures are at their lowest then, ranging between 2ºC (36ºF) and 11ºC (52ºF) on average.
